Output 6ccb7c88d20a71412420558cdc41c1238f6838a85e9d6fc1e6a9f52566eab9c3:0

value
19911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d4f2cfb6d3400b5e2fe6f68db91d2a43cbe2d0 OP_EQUAL
address
3Fd7jd2Jk56LZhdaM1wPVC8NUAkhYQnS3b
transaction
6ccb7c88d20a71412420558cdc41c1238f6838a85e9d6fc1e6a9f52566eab9c3
confirmations
133860
spent
true